ORMD:
Products containing alcohol, or are under pressure (like hairspray,
mousse etc) are classified as ORMD. (We have been told ORMD stands for
Other Regulated Material Dangerous.) It is
cost prohibitive to send ORMD products by air as an additional $40.00
to $50.00 service charge is applied to each shipment. ORMD products
can be sent GROUND, but can NOT be sent via USPS Priority Mail as
most Priority Mail packages go by air.

Checking your address ... for US States &
Territories
After 9-11 the US Postal Service has instituted an address verification
process on their web site. in other words, if you enter a mailing
address that is not in the USPS database they will not recognize it.
Naturally they will not allow us to print a label for an unknown
address.
- If address changes occurred in your area, or
- If you live off shore (for example in Porto Rico) or
- If you have not checked recently
we suggest you go to
http://www.usps.com click on make a shipping label and then
click on GO. This should bring you to a blank address form. Fill
out the blank form using your address as both return address and ship to
address. When you are done click on continue. The
http://www.usps.com will check the
address you entered to see if it matches with an address in their data
base. If it does not they will give you options to help find the
address they have on file for your area. When you see your matching
address proceed to make a label (click the box indicating you want to
make a label without paying for postage). You now have an exact print
out of your address as required by the USPS data base. Transfer the
information from this print out to your order form, when ordering. Your
letter carrier knows you so can make deliveries even if the address is
not perfect. The computer at
http://www.usps.com Does NOT know you and does not allow deviations.

FOB Shipping Point of Origin:
For those new to the shipping world FOB (Free On Board
or sometimes Freight On Board) Point of Origin is
the legal way to telling you that this is the point where the sale is
made and the goods become yours. That is to say when the shipping
company picks up your order, the "title transfers to you" and the hair
products become your property and your responsibility. Should your hair
products be damaged in transit, this is your responsibility. We assume
you would want your hair products so we would ship replacement products
to you, and charge your account accordingly. FedEx, UPS and other
shipping companies include insurance of $100.00 in their shipping
charge. Should your package be damaged or completely lost you must
notify us (include pictures of the damage) so we can submit a claim on
your behalf. When and if the shipping company pays us we credit your
account.
